This book provides an in-depth exploration of autonomous vehicle technology, tracing its evolution from initial trials to the sophisticated systems of today. It delves into the core technologies, such as sensors, artificial intelligence, and connectivity, while examining their transformative impact on traffic, urban planning, and societal behavior. The book also addresses critical legal, ethical, and economic considerations, highlighting challenges and opportunities for industries and governments. Finally, it envisions a future where human-driven and autonomous vehicles coexist, shaping smarter cities and more efficient transportation systems. This is a comprehensive guide to understanding the revolution autonomous vehicles bring to mobility and society.
